WebNov 29, 2024 · Song year: 1991. Tom Cochrane's “Life Is a Highway” contains a metaphor right in the title, setting the tone for the rest of the song. The song opens with a simile, “life's like a road that you travel on.”. The song's central theme compares life to a highway, telling listeners how important it is to keep riding. WebNov 28, 2011 · Music to my Ears. This idiom emphasizes extremely pleasant news. “When our boss announced the three day weekend, it was music to our ears.” “I was afraid the battery was dead, but when I heard my car start, it was music to my ears.” Set Something to Music A musician writing a tune for lyrics is “setting the lyrics to music”.
